The fund is an actively-managed ETF that seeks to achieve its objective by investing in a portfolio of common stocks of companies in emerging markets that in the opinion of Polen Capital Management, LLC, the sub-advisor to the fund, have a sustainable competitive advantage. Under normal circumstances, the fund will invest at least 80% of its net assets, at the time of initial purchase, in equity or equity-related securities of issuers that are located in an emerging market country. The fund is non-diversified.
